Looks OK (safe) to me: it's compatible both with old and new way.
I'd only suggest to maybe change this to '(hz1 > 1024)', because
it's the biggest HZ currently in the kernel, so this compatibility
should be 100%. I think, you could leave 1 empty line before this
'if', as well. (Btw., aren't these overflows connected with
CONFIG_HIGH_RES_TIMERS?)

On the other hand this 'hz' still looks 'strange' here - I don't
understand, why, a bit earlier it's:

	if (!hz)
		hz = get_hz();

while 'else' would use: hz == get_user_hz();
So, probably I miss something, but even after your patch, there
could be different outputs here...
